Manchester United have been given a boost in their revived pursuit of Bayern Munich full-back Alphonso Davies.
According to several sources in the British press, signing a new left-back is on Jason Wilcox’s agenda ahead of the summer transfer campaign.

This season, Luke Shaw has been the club’s first and almost exclusive choice for the role, with Patrick Dorgu playing in a more advanced role, and then suffering an injury. Tyrell Malacia is already an afterthought at Carrington and will certainly see out his contract in June.
While Shaw managed to hold his own in this peculiar 40-match campaign, United will certainly need additional options, as they’ll be looking to once again compete on multiple fronts starting next season, and they’re already on the right track to securing Champions League qualification under Michael Carrick.
Last season, Alphonso Davies was one of the main targets on Man Utd’s shortlist , but he ended up extending his contract with Bayern Munich.
Nevertheless, the Premier League giants have recently revived their interest in Davies , as confirmed by Bayern expert Christian Falk.
The trusted German journalist provided additional insight on the 25-year-old’s situation in Bavaria and the recent rumours linking him to Liverpool, while revealing that the Bundesliga giants no longer consider him among the untouchables, especially amidst his recurring injury woes.
“It’s a very interesting rumour suggesting Alphonso Davies was offered to Liverpool by intermediaries. It’s true that there are thoughts within Bayern, as the Canadian has picked up yet another injury, that if a big offer is on the table, perhaps they would sell him,” wrote Falk in his latest column for CF Bayern Insider .
“Before, it was clear that FC Bayern need this player; he’s one of the best in the team. Now, however, they’re thinking that they could perhaps replace him if there’s a lot of money on the table, because his salary is pretty high.
“His agent held difficult talks with the club when Alphonso was signing. He hasn’t done anything to dispel these rumours. He’s quiet on the situation. So, I have a growing suspicion with regard to this subject!”
Davies has been playing his football at Bayern since January 2019. Despite his tender age, he swiftly became a regular starter at the club.
In August 2020, the Canadian was one of the main stars of the show when the German giants eradicated Barcelona by eight goals to two in the quarter-finals of the Champions League.
The then-youngster was hailed for ‘upstaging’ Lionel Messi , with his teammate, Joshua Kimmich, applauding his ‘unbelievable’ performance.
However, a series of injuries have taken their toll on Davies’ career momentum, with the player missing more than 100 matches since joining the Bavarian club.
So while Bayern’s willingness to entertain offers might be an exciting development, it should also raise some red flags, as signing Davies wouldn’t be a cheap operation, and it entails high risks.
